We are looking for a Product Governance Analyst to help us ensure that our products and services meet the highest standards and ensure we are delivering excellent client outcomes.
Working between Investment Management and Compliance you will play a key role in periodically reviewing our products and services to enable and support good client outcomes across all service lines.
Your other key responsibilities will be:
- Providing accurate data and MI to support the Product Governance Framework and board reporting.
- Overseeing the process for new products and services.
- Periodically review and maintain Target Market Assessments and Fair Value Assessments.
- Managing and reviewing Risk of Harms assessments, with a focus on the proper treatment of Vulnerable Clients.
- Oversight of the firm’s Consumer Duty Dashboards and metrics.
- Monitoring and completion of due diligence processes to ensure we comply with responsibilities as a Manufacturer and Distributor.
- Prepare board papers, annual attestations, and regular reports on product governance matters, including conducting peer group comparisons and competition analysis.
